73.42Level 21 — common-tone chord as bridge between unrelated keys
C major → A♭ major.
Common tones?
C.
C major: C-E-G.
A♭ major: A♭-C-E♭.
Hold C.
Use an intermediate chord containing C, perhaps:
Fm/C
or another appropriate color.
Now C acts as continuity.
